If you have ever dreamt of being in one of the most fantastic places on our planet – with almost no signs of civilization – then you simply must visit Tuva. Here, in the geographic center of Asia, the rugged and uniquely beautiful highland steppe was the birthplace of shamanism and throat-singing.
You will have the opportunity of staying in comfortable Tuvan yurts at Camp Ai (in the Tuvan language, ‘ai’ means ‘moon’), on the banks of the Be’g-Hem (Great Yenisei River). The traditional dwellings – yurts – are equipped with modern amenities, such as shower cabins, chemical toilets, electricity, and elegantly – styled furniture. The camp consists of 15 yurts, each designed for 2 persons. Their circular thick felt walls will insulate you from the elements, but will not prevent you from sensing the elemental spirit of traditional Tuvan life.
While at the camp, you will be able to enjoy free time in the bar, buy souvenirs, play volleyball, or ride on a camel. All meals are included in the cost of the accommodation. The team of local chefs will be happy to provide various European dishes, and also traditional cuisine.
The camp is situated 25 km from Kyzyl – the capital of Tuva – and, while staying, there you can choose excursions and activities to suit your interests.
